At the Liberty:"The Fantastic Four: First Steps"

DAYTON — Set in a 1960s-inspired, retro-futuristic world, “The Fantastic Four: First Steps” introduces Marvel’s First Family—Mister Fantastic (Pedro Pascal), Invisible Woman (Vanessa Kirby), Human Torch (Joseph Quinn), and The Thing (Ebon Moss-Bachrach) as they face their most daunting challenge yet. Forced to balance their roles as heroes with the strength of their family bond, they must defend Earth from a ravenous space god called Galactus (Ralph Ineson) and his enigmatic Herald, Silver Surfer (Julia Garner). And if Galactus’ plan to devour the entire planet and everyone on it weren’t bad enough, it suddenly gets very personal.

The Rotten Tomatoes audience rates “The Fantastic Four: First Steps” an enthusiastic 91% saying they loved the retro vibe, believable family dynamic, and finally did Galactus right. The critics’ rating is 86% with a consensus that “The Fantastic Four: First Steps” leaves the audience feeling good and offers an inspiring, idyllic story with a noncynical sincerity needed in our world now. Rated PG-13 for action/violence and some language, and has a runtime of 115 minutes.

Chris Fascione’s “Juggling Funny Stories” on August 15 will have the audience laughing out loud as family entertainer Chris Fascione brings children’s stories to life with his high-spirited and innovative performance. Full of energy, humor, and imagination, Chris creates colorful characters through his unique combination of acting, storytelling, comedy, and juggling. A Storytelling World Award winner, Chris brings out the kid in everyone, as adults and children have fun participating in the show. Admission is free for the show on Friday, August 15, at 10:30 am.
